Q: Can I really learn German with a horror game like Alan Wake 2?
A: Yes, Alan Wake 2 is great for learning German because the intense story, repeated phrases and strong visuals make vocabulary and expressions easier to remember.

Q: How should I use this Alan Wake II video for German listening practice?
A: First watch a section without pausing, then rewatch it, pause before each line, repeat the German out loud and compare your understanding with my explanations so both listening and vocabulary improve.
